The invention is directed to compositions comprising decellularized bone marrow extracellular matrix and uses thereof. Methods for repairing or regenerating defective, diseased, damaged or ischemic tissues or organs in a subject, preferably a human, using the decellularized bone marrow extracellular matrix of the invention are also provided. The invention is further directed to a medical device, preferably a stent or an artificial heart, and biocompatible materials, preferably a tissue regeneration scaffold, comprising decellularized bone marrow extracellular matrix for implantation into a subject.
